Understanding the Hidden Wiki Dark Web

The Hidden Wiki serves as a directory for .onion sites, providing links to various resources, services, and forums found exclusively on the dark web. Initially launched as a community-driven platform, it has evolved over the years to accommodate a range of interests, including gambling-related sites. Users can expect a mixture of legitimate services and dubious enterprises within this underground web. It’s essential for individuals engaging with these platforms to approach them with caution, ensuring they are well-informed about the potential dangers and legal implications.

How to Download and Install the Tor Browser

Once a VPN is set up, the next step involves downloading the Tor browser, specifically designed for navigating the dark web. This browser improves anonymity by routing your traffic through various servers, obscuring your digital footprint. Installation is straightforward: download from the official Tor Project website to ensure you receive an unaltered version. After installation, familiarize yourself with its features, such as the option to open new identities and manage your security settings.

Exploring Hidden Search Engines for Betting

Many users may not realize that dedicated search engines exist solely for accessing .onion sites. These search engines can help players find gambling sites that are deemed trustworthy within the dark web community. Examples include DuckDuckGo’s onion version, Ahmia, and others that focus on indexing dark web content. Utilize these tools to streamline your search process while ensuring you stay informed about new and emerging sites that may offer unique betting opportunities.

How Decentralization is Shaping Online Betting

Decentralized platforms that leverage blockchain technology might begin to emerge, offering increased transparency and security. This shift could lead to the development of peer-to-peer betting systems where players set the terms of their wagers, thereby eliminating the house edge inherent in traditional setups. Understanding how these structures operate will be key for players looking to leverage future opportunities in dark web gambling.
